Introduction to Functional Programming (Prentice Hall International Series in Computing Science) [Richard Bird] on *FREE* shipping on qualifying. Roger L. Wainwright, Introducing functional programming in discrete . Philip Wadler, The essence of functional programming, Proceedings of the 19th ACM. for Imperative Functional Programming by Simon Peyton Jones and Philip Wadler. .. Richard Bird and Philip Wadler’s Introduction to Functional Programming.

Author: Nikozahn Vudoshura
Country: Cape Verde
Language: English (Spanish)
Genre: Science
Published (Last): 6 November 2014
Pages: 118
PDF File Size: 20.7 Mb
ePub File Size: 2.60 Mb
ISBN: 965-7-44682-840-6
Downloads: 99004
Price: Free* [*Free Regsitration Required]
Uploader: Mora

While set up as an introductory book to languages of the Haskell family, the book actually has a fair share of theory which modern tutorials of Haskell lack. Bird and Wadler 1st ed.

Introduction to Functional Programming by Richard S. Bird

Michael rated it it was amazing Mar 17, The book is self-contained, assuming no prior knowledge of programming and is suitable as an introductory undergraduate text for first- programking second-year students.

Julie Harmon rated it it was amazing Mar 24, No trivia or quizzes yet. Trivia About Introduction to F I can understand that as well.

It presents a simple model of evaluation, discusses efficiency e. There are other authors named Richard Bird: Read the first edition, since subsequent editions are rewritten more in the “programming language overview” style.

John Liao funcgional it liked it Jun 07, To see what your friends thought of this book, please sign up. Andreas Meingast rated it really liked wadlfr Apr 14, Apr 20, Matthew Chan rated it it was amazing. To ask other readers questions about Introduction birdd Functional Programmingplease sign up.

  LA CIENCIA IMAGINARIA OSCAR DE LA BORBOLLA PDF

Jobaer Chowdhury rated it it was amazing Apr 15, The four instead of five stars is because, unfor I highly recommend the book to biird looking for a solid base of functional programming theory. I probably should read it again but If I recall well Monads and Lenses were not explicitly explained in book or course. In the popular literature about Haskell a lot of digital ink is spilled over Monads, but really they’re no big deal conceptually.

On the other hand the implications of Monadic computations are far-reaching. Language-agnostic to the extent that most code can be easily translated to most modern functional programming languages.

Bar Shirtcliff rated it really liked it Feb 14, Lists with This Book. Eduardo rated it really liked it Jul 13, The focus is mainly on the theoretical side, being many of the functtional proofs. As a functionap point, the technique of program specification and derivation by inverse functions is elegantly described, easily mechanized, and of lasting value.

Related to this I have seen interviews with Eric Meijer where he talked about preferring the first edition of this book because is was more conceptual and not Haskell specific.

Introduction to Functional Programming

I think I should have read it better in Same guy who also brought you generics with type erasure in Java. Tom rated it really liked it Aug 04, Adolfo rated it functiobal it Jun 04, Daniel rated it really liked it Feb 01, Thanks for telling us about the problem.

  APLOMOS DEL CABALLO PDF

It uses a Functional Language that looks Introductioon Miranda. All in all, it is an excellent book with which to hone theory, and for that I can’t recommend it enough.

Chris rated it really liked it Dec 07, That said, SICP is a comprehensive overview of the essence of computer science narrated using Scheme and functional programming, while Bird and Wadler is a tutorial in functional abstractions and type-directed programming through Miranda, a precursor to Haskell.

Pepe rated it it was amazing Nov 07, Mace Ousley rated it it was amazing Nov 04, I have started reading the first book as a PDF and can see his point.

Published by Prentice Hall first published January 1st Daouda Traore rated it really liked it Nov introductiin, It is also a book, meaning some things are outdated. Jun 18, Karl rated it really liked it Shelves: What was great about the treatment was that each new concept was introduced with little fanfare. Goodreads helps you keep track of books you want to read.

Nowadays probably Haskell would be used. For me, this was a great book for learning Haskell. Look up some of his presentations on YouTube Introduction to Functional Programming by Richard S.